Food Direct

Imagine parents walking for miles in baking heat while their children suffer from lack of food and severe diarrhoea. Even when they reach their destination, there’s no guarantee they will receive the proper care they urgently need.

food direct logo
boy with sack on his head in Niger

It’s the harsh reality facing millions of people in developing countries around the world, but the picture is slowly changing for the better. Concern has developed an innovative way of distributing food, knowledge and skills to those who need  it most.

Innovative solution

Food Direct tackles food shortages and their effects at the source. Most aid distribution involves parents and children travelling gruelling distances to feeding centres. By contrast, with this approach Concern operates within communities.

By establishing local clinics, outreach workers and locally trained volunteers, a severely malnourished child is no longer required to make a life-threatening journey for treatment. Instead children are nursed back to health in their own homes, by their mother or carer.

Helping thousands of children

In 2006, Concern helped treat almost 30,000 malnourished children in eight countries across Africa, including Ethiopia, Niger and Malawi. But there are over a million more children in these countries who are malnourished and need support now.
